An ongoing police incident and multi-vehicle crash has sparked travel chaos for Scots on the M90.
Traffic Scotland warned motorists of a 'police incident' at around 6:15am on Friday morning, November 5.
A statement read: "Both slip roads from the M90 to the A823 currently blocked due to a police incident. Take care on the approach."
One passing driver reported 'police are everywhere' at the scene.
Another said the incident had been ongoing since the early hours of the morning.

A man who died following a road crash on the M90 near Perth has been formally identified. Police Scotland has revealed he was Kenneth Cheyne, aged 55, from Turriff in Aberdeenshire. Mr Turriff was the driver and sole occupant of a lorry which left the road while travelling southbound near Junction 10 around 7.20am on Thursday, November 4. He was pronounced dead at the scene.
